Andy Warhol: Mao (After) - Drawing from the image found in Mao's famous "Red Book", Andy Warhol, in this series, "takes aim" at the enemy of the capitalist system, the Chinese communist leader Mao Zedong. Despite the repetition, each screen print becomes an autonomous entity, thanks to the use of different color ranges that alter the face and expression of the character, imbuing it with different emotional connotations.

What does "Screenprints After" of Andy Warhol Mao means?

After means they have been realized AFTER the artist's death, therefore they are not signed and, for this reason, have affordable prices.

Sunday B Morning, is the name of the publishing company that keeps printing the famous screenprins by Andy Warhol.

The quality of the Mao Screenprins is exceptional, they are accurate and faithful to the originals, they just have a lower value as collector's item.

The price of these screenprints is much lower compared to the original signed artworks.
